From 94f9e4a1be68b76980e9a49b4120916397999a01 Mon Sep 17 00:00:00 2001 From: Karl Tauber Date: Wed, 3 Aug 2022 13:16:43 +0200 Subject: [PATCH] fixed missing UI value `MenuItem.acceleratorDelimiter` on macOS (was `null`, is now an empty string) --- CHANGELOG.md | 8 ++++++++ .../main/resources/com/formdev/flatlaf/FlatLaf.properties | 4 ++-- .../dumps/uidefaults/FlatDarkLaf_1.8.0-mac.txt | 2 +- .../dumps/uidefaults/FlatLightLaf_1.8.0-mac.txt | 2 +- 4 files changed, 12 insertions(+), 4 deletions(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index f38de045..95f0b646 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,6 +1,14 @@ FlatLaf Change Log ================== +## 2.5-SNAPSHOT + +#### Fixed bugs + +- Fixed missing UI value `MenuItem.acceleratorDelimiter` on macOS. (was `null`, + is now an empty string) + + ## 2.4 #### New features and improvements diff --git a/flatlaf-core/src/main/resources/com/formdev/flatlaf/FlatLaf.properties b/flatlaf-core/src/main/resources/com/formdev/flatlaf/FlatLaf.properties index 5d24952f..2c50af92 100644 --- a/flatlaf-core/src/main/resources/com/formdev/flatlaf/FlatLaf.properties +++ b/flatlaf-core/src/main/resources/com/formdev/flatlaf/FlatLaf.properties @@ -442,8 +442,8 @@ MenuItem.iconTextGap = 6 MenuItem.textAcceleratorGap = 24 MenuItem.textNoAcceleratorGap = 6 MenuItem.acceleratorArrowGap = 2 -MenuItem.acceleratorDelimiter = + -[mac]MenuItem.acceleratorDelimiter = +MenuItem.acceleratorDelimiter = "+" +[mac]MenuItem.acceleratorDelimiter = "" # for MenuItem.selectionType = underline MenuItem.underlineSelectionBackground = @menuHoverBackground diff --git a/flatlaf-testing/dumps/uidefaults/FlatDarkLaf_1.8.0-mac.txt b/flatlaf-testing/dumps/uidefaults/FlatDarkLaf_1.8.0-mac.txt index 9f711d9b..b74ba588 100644 --- a/flatlaf-testing/dumps/uidefaults/FlatDarkLaf_1.8.0-mac.txt +++ b/flatlaf-testing/dumps/uidefaults/FlatDarkLaf_1.8.0-mac.txt @@ -25,7 +25,7 @@ #---- MenuItem ---- -- MenuItem.acceleratorDelimiter - +- MenuItem.acceleratorDelimiter + + MenuItem.acceleratorDelimiter diff --git a/flatlaf-testing/dumps/uidefaults/FlatLightLaf_1.8.0-mac.txt b/flatlaf-testing/dumps/uidefaults/FlatLightLaf_1.8.0-mac.txt index 9f711d9b..b74ba588 100644 --- a/flatlaf-testing/dumps/uidefaults/FlatLightLaf_1.8.0-mac.txt +++ b/flatlaf-testing/dumps/uidefaults/FlatLightLaf_1.8.0-mac.txt @@ -25,7 +25,7 @@ #---- MenuItem ---- -- MenuItem.acceleratorDelimiter - +- MenuItem.acceleratorDelimiter + + MenuItem.acceleratorDelimiter